Solution

The correct option is B False
The compound can be formed either by a combination of nonmetals like H2O which is formed by the combination of nonmetals hydrogen and oxygen or by a combination of metals and nonmetals. For example NaCl is formed by a combination of metals Na and nonmetal Cl.
